What to check before for buildings near the M101 bus in Hamilton Heights

  • Use the M101-bus focus to speed up commute checks, then confirm walk times to your exact stops during the hours you’ll travel.
  • Filter for “with available apartments” if you want current options, and double-check lease terms, move-in dates, and any required documents.
  • Review the building’s Q&A for recurring issues (elevators, heat/hot water timing, noise) and ask the super about how those issues are handled.
  • Before you apply, confirm the full monthly cost beyond the asking rent (deposit, broker fee if applicable, and utility responsibilities).
  • If the building is rent-stabilized or has other regulatory status shown on Openigloo, ask what renewal process applies and what changes you can expect at renewal.
